Abstract
Molluscan Shellfish are polygon datasets that contain distribution information for the molluscan shellfish species; sea scallop (Placopectin magellanicus), american oysters (Crassostrea virginica), atlantic surf clams (Spisula solidissima), blue mussels (Mytilus edulis), european oysters (Ostrea edulis), hard clams (Mercenaria mercenaria), razor clam (Ensis directus) and softshell clams (Mya arenaria) for the coast of Maine . Polygons are based on locations indicated by town officials, harvesters, Harbormasters, MEDMR biologists, MEDMR specialists, MEDMR Marine Patrol officers or MEDMR scientists from February 2008 to September 2010. POLYGON codes include: Town, County, Species, NOAA_Chart, Updated, Acres and Source. A COMMENT field indicates sea scallop locations obtained from MEDMR sea scallop tow survey data generated during 2005 - 2009.
Purpose
Though primarily based on harvestable locations, shellfish species distributions are helpful tools for planning activities. Baseline data of shellfish species distributions in Maine provides a foundation for future data updates. Data at this scale is suitable for use in generalized studies and local planning.
Supplemental Information
These layers may not be current or complete, as shellfish distributions could change over time and portions of the Maine coast may not have been included.

Process Description
Sea scallop tow survey data insertion- Sea scallop tow survey data for years 2005 through 2009 were extracted from the MEDMR's MARVIN database, and placed into a Microsoft Excel spreadsheet format. This spreadsheet was converted into a Microsoft Access database file, and imported into the ArcGIS project file. The X -Y coordinates were plotted in ArcMap, using geographic coordinate system "North American Datum 1983". Polygons were drawn around points containing reported quantities of at least one sea scallop. There were two points in the 2005 sea scallop data that were located over a land mass: they contained reported quantities of zero scallops, and they were excluded from the sea scallop shapefile. There were two points in the 2006 sea scallop data that were south of Mount Desert Island. Since there was no reference town in the "towns-24K" file to correspond to these points, they were excluded from the sea scallop shapefile. There were many points in the 2009 sea scallop data that were outside of the three-mile limit of state jurisdiction; since there was no reference town in the "towns-24K" file to correspond to these points, they were excluded from the sea scallop shapefile.

Process Description
Map construction- Series of paper maps were created for each coastal town, depicting the nearshore coastline. These maps were created using electronic National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) charts in ArcMap 9.2, which were then converted to .PDF documents. Landmarks were used as reference points from one map to the next, so participants could stay oriented throughout the map series.

Process Description
Data collection- Paper map series were sent to town officials, harvesters, Harbormasters, MEDMR specialists, MEDMR scientists and MEDMR biologists. All recipients were asked to mark molluscan shellfish resource locations, observed within the last two to three years, on the maps. They could use a different pen color for each species, or write the species name in the marked areas. They were asked to send the maps back to the project manager. Two people chose to mark resources on paper NOAA charts, which were returned to the project manager. Some people marked only commercially viable shellfish locations, and other people marked all observed locations of shellfish resources. The project manager met in person with MEDMR Marine Patrol officers: the officers marked paper NOAA charts with shellfish locations.

Process Description
Digitization of data- marked maps and charts were scanned into Adobe Acrobat 6.0 Professional, and a .PDF document was created. The .PDF documents were georeferenced to the appropriate electronic NOAA chart, and polygons were created to encompass each marked location of molluscan shellfish. Where multiple sources indicated a specific location, the most "hands-on" source category was used as the source. Some polygons are composites from several sources, and show the largest boundary indicated by the multiple sources. Shellfish polygons that were confirmed by MEDMR Marine Patrol officers, and those polygons that were significantly modified by an officer's knowledge, were credited in the attribute tables as being sourced from the Marine Patrol.

Format Information Content
MEGIS has made all vector layers, in the Maine GIS Internet Data Catalog, available in ESRI's ArcView shapefile format. A shapefile is a simple non-topological format that stores the geometry and attribute information for a set of geographic features as a set of vector (point, line, polygon) coordinates. Shapefiles draw quickly and directly in ArcView, ArcGIS, ArcExplorer. Shapefiles are a compatible data type for many other types of GIS software. Three files are fundamental to each shapefile: .shp stores the feature geometry (shape and location information); .shx stores the index of the feature geometry; .dbf a dBASE (TM) file stores the attribute information for the features. Other index files may be created to help speed analysis and query: these file formats are .sbn .sbx .ain .aix .fbn and .fbx. In addition you may find projection .prj, and metadata .xml, files associated with shapefiles.
